Transaction 6c8bab3eeff9ffd0a45545b7a5d168189dd3af412c502dd15510c1b34fa7f952
4 Input
1 Outputs
- 6c8bab3eeff9ffd0a45545b7a5d168189dd3af412c502dd15510c1b34fa7f952:0
value 339175
address 3QoXSLNCDtQ7QqsWXsh5byejWWb3iZqd7e